Ruler wall art

You can scoop up old rulers–some with cool retro logos–for a few bucks. These bird prints, cut from the pages of a dime-store book, match the old-fashioned vibe. We used wood glue to affix the rulers to cheap wooden frames. The rulers are applied differently on each frame to keep things interesting. Source: bhg

Tablecloth wall art

In this comfy dining room, tablecloths stand in for wall art. Simply stretch and frame sections of tablecloth in frames painted fun, bright colors. Leave the glass off one frame and hot-glue a starfish to the center. This is great rehab for stained cloths destined for the trash. Source: meredith

Hanky Wall Art

It’s hard to beat the funky retro patterns found in old handkerchiefs. Put them to good use on your walls. We used mat board and cut-to-size glass (your local hardware store can cut glass for you), then displayed them in groupings of like colors. Source: meredith

Elegant wall decoration

In living rooms, people are usually sitting, so artwork should be lower. A good way to ensure you’re placing artwork at the right height is to hang it one hand width above the sofa. Source: bhg

Pretty Floral Wall Art

You’d be surprised how beautiful close-up photos of flowers can be–even the snapshots you take with your own digital camera. Take your favorite flower images, have them enlarged to enhance the details, and get them printed on canvas, rather than photo paper. Source: meredith

Frame wall decoration

Most people pass right by photo frames that have lost their glass. Simply give them a fresh coat of paint (clean white always looks fab and fresh), then display a beautiful object inside like a plate. Source: bhg
